• GetHashCode()
  • ToString() namespace_path.class_name formatidagi obektning ramziy korinishini qaytaradi. Bu format ful qualified name
  • Метод Описание




    Download 70,5 Kb.
    bet11/12
    Sana18.05.2024
    Hajmi70,5 Kb.
    #241174
    1   ...   4   5   6   7   8   9   10   11   12
    Bog'liq
    22-09

    Метод





    Описание





    Equals()

    Agar solishtirilgan ob'ektlar bir xil xotira maydonini egallasa, true qaytaradi. Odatiy bo'lib, u mos yozuvlar turlarining ob'ektlarini solishtirish uchun tuzilgan. Ob'ektlarga tuzilgan turlarni qo'llash uchun ushbu usul va unga qo`shma bo'lgan GetHashCode() usuli o'z usullaringiz bilan ortiqcha yuklangan bo'lishi kerak.




    GetHashCode()

    Ushbu turdagi ob'ektning o'ziga xos nusxasini aniqlaydigan butun son ID qiymatini qaytaradi. Unikal xeshni yaratadi.




    GetType()

    Usul ushbu usul chaqirilgan ob'ektni to'liq tavsiflovchi Type () ob'ektini qaytaradi. Bu barcha ob'ektlarda taqdim etilgan bajarish vaqtini aniqlash usuli (Runtime Type Identification - RTTI).




    ToString()

    namespace_path.class_name formatidagi ob'ektning ramziy ko'rinishini qaytaradi. Bu format ful qualified name deb ataladi, bu to'liq malakali nomdir. Agar tur har qanday nom maydonidan tashqarida aniqlansa, faqat sinf nomi nomlar maydoni yo'lisiz qaytariladi. Ushbu usul ob'ektning ichki holati haqida ma'lumotni nom-qiymat formatida taqdim etish uchun ortiqcha yuklanishi mumkin.




    Finalize()

    Ushbu usulning asosiy maqsadi gc - Garbare Collector to'g'ri ishlashi uchun uni yo'q qilishdan oldin ushbu sinf ob'ekti egallagan barcha resurslarni bo'shatishdir.













    Download 70,5 Kb.
    1   ...   4   5   6   7   8   9   10   11   12




    Download 70,5 Kb.